Karen Llagas Author

Karen Llagas is a poet, translator and lecturer in Tagalog/Filipino at the University of California, Berkeley. She is recipient of the prestigious Filamore Tabios Sr. Memorial Poetry Prize and a Hedgebrook Residency. Her first collection of poetry, Archipelago Dust, was published in 2010 and her poems have appeared in anthologies such as Troubling Borders, The Place That Inhabits Us, and Field of Mirrors among others. She earned her BA at the Ateneo de Manila in the Philippines and an MFA in Creative Writing at Warren Wilson College. She is the author of Basic Tagalog.
